What This Does
Imagine every single task in your tourism business – from checking in a guest, preparing an activity, to closing up for the day – being done perfectly, every single time. That's what Standard Operating Procedures (SOPs) help you achieve!
In simple terms, an SOP is just a clear, step-by-step instruction manual for how to complete a specific task. Our 'Create SOPs Guide' doesn't just tell you what SOPs are; it actually walks you through how to write your very own, tailored specifically for your business.
Why is this a game-changer for your tourism operation?
Consistency is Key: Your guests will always receive the same high-quality service, no matter who's on duty.
Easy Training: New team members can get up to speed much faster, understanding exactly how things are done.
Reduce Mistakes: Clear instructions mean fewer errors and less rework, saving you time and resources.
Empower Your Team: Everyone knows their role and how to perform it effectively, leading to a more confident and efficient team.
Peace of Mind: You'll know that even when you're not there, your business is running just as you'd want it to.

Step-by-Step Guide
Alright, now for the fun part – creating your very own SOPs! Don't worry, it's a process that we'll break down into simple, manageable steps. Our guide will prompt you with questions and give you examples along the way.
Here’s how you can use the guide to start writing your SOPs:
Step 1: Choose Your First Task
Start small! Think about one task in your business that's done often, is critical, or perhaps causes a few headaches. It could be "Guest Check-in Procedure" or "Daily Equipment Safety Check."
In the guide: We'll ask you to identify the task you want to create an SOP for. Write down the name of the task clearly, e.g., "Opening Procedure for the Gift Shop."
Step 2: Define the Purpose and Scope
Why are you creating this SOP? What's the end goal? Who is this SOP for, and what specific part of the task does it cover?
In the guide: You'll be prompted to explain the 'Why' (e.g., "To ensure a smooth and welcoming start to the guest's experience") and the 'Who' (e.g., "All front desk staff").
Step 3: Gather Information and List the Main Steps
Now, let's get into the nitty-gritty. Think about every single action involved in completing your chosen task. It's often helpful to actually do the task yourself, or watch someone else do it, and write down each step as it happens.
In the guide: We encourage you to list the major stages first. For example, for "Guest Check-in":
Welcome the guest.
Verify booking details.
Process payment.
Provide key/access information.
Offer local information.
Wish them a pleasant stay.
Step 4: Break Down Each Main Step into Detailed Actions
This is where you add the specifics! Under each main step, list the individual actions in the correct order. Be super clear and precise.
In the guide: For "Welcome the guest," you might add:
1.1. Greet guest with a smile and make eye contact.
1.2. Use a friendly greeting, e.g., "Welcome to [Your Business Name], how can I help you today?"
1.3. Ask for their name and booking reference.
Step 5: Add Important Details and Resources
Think about anything else someone would need to know to complete the task perfectly. This includes:
Tools or equipment needed: "Tablet for check-in," "POS system."
Specific forms to fill out: "Guest registration card."
Safety considerations: "Ensure clear pathway to exit."
Troubleshooting tips: "If booking not found, check alternative spellings or call supervisor."
Reference materials: "Refer to local attraction brochure rack."
Who is responsible for what (if applicable): "Receptionist responsible for check-in process."
In the guide: You'll find sections to add these vital extra pieces of information. Don't forget to include screenshots or photos if they make a step clearer – a picture is worth a thousand words!
Step 6: Review and Refine
Once you've written everything down, it's time to test it out! Ask a team member (especially a new one) to follow the SOP without any other instructions. Did they understand everything? Were there any missing steps or confusing parts?
In the guide: We prompt you to review your SOP. Make any necessary adjustments based on this feedback. The goal is for anyone, even someone completely new, to follow it successfully.
Step 7: Organise and Implement
Decide where your SOPs will live so everyone can easily access them. This could be a shared drive, a physical binder, or directly within your Tourism Accelerator platform if you have a document storage feature.
In the guide: We'll give you ideas on how to best store and share your SOPs. Once they're ready, train your team on them!
Step 8: Keep Them Alive!
SOPs aren't set in stone forever. As your business evolves, so too should your procedures. Schedule regular reviews (e.g., quarterly or annually) to ensure they're still relevant and effective.
In the guide: We remind you to set a review date. This ensures your SOPs remain helpful and up-to-date.
